4. The King’s Choice (2016)
- Director: Erik Poppe
- Featured casts: Jesper Christensen, Anders Baasmo Christiansen and Karl Markovics
- IMDb ratings: 7.1
“The King’s Choice”, a biographical war film, was written by Harald Rosenlw-Eeg and Jan TrygveRyneland. It features outstanding performances from Jesper Christensen, Anders Baasmo Christiansen, Tuva Novotny and Katharina Schüttler.
The film, directed by Erik Poppe, is about King Haakon VII of Norway and the Norwegian royal family during World War II, as the country prepared to be invaded by the Germans.
During those stressful days, the king had to make a brave decision that would determine the future of the country and redefine his legacy as a leader.

9. Kesari (2019)
- Director: Anurag Singh
- Featured casts: Akshay Kumar, Parineeti Chopra and Suvinder Vicky
- IMDb ratings: 7.4
Anurag Singh directed and co-wrote the Indian Hindi military film “Kesari”.
The Battle of Saragarhi was a bloody battle in which 10,000 Afridi and Orakzai Pashtun tribesmen attacked the British Indian Army’s 36th Sikh outpost at Saragarhi.
However, only 21 men were stationed to protect the territory. Havildar Ishar Singh, a brave soldier, led his troops through one of the most gruesome battles in history as enemies looked down on them.
While offering an up-close look at the conflict, the film also provides insight into the events leading up to it.

13. A Bridge Too Far (1977)
- Director: Richard Attenborough
- Featured casts: Sean Connery, Ryan O’Neal and Michael Caine
- IMDb ratings: 7.4
With a large cast that includes over a hundred well-known names and faces from three different countries, “A Bridge Too Far” is a visionary work, grand in execution and approach. In fact, that’s the first impression you’ll get while watching the movie.
What little the film does in terms of being a war movie is trying to expose and bring to light the inadequacy and misjudgment that threatened and led to the failure of Operation Market Garden.
Meanwhile, this was intended for Allied forces to capture a series of bridges in the German-occupied Netherlands for strategic and combat advantages.
